The hamos KRS is an industrial recycling system designed to refine mixed plastic streams, including black plastics, into cleaner, single‑polymer fractions. It uses electrostatic separation to handle materials that challenge other sorting systems.

It is not a front‑end shredder or washer. Instead, it integrates into a recycling train after initial preprocessing stages.
Electrostatic separation works independently of colour and optical reflectivity. This makes it effective on black and dark materials that typical optical sorters cannot separate reliably.
By separating plastics based on electrical behaviour, the KRS helps produce cleaner ABS, PS, and PP fractions with improved material quality.
The system is designed to complement upstream size reduction, metal removal, and density separation equipment.
Continuous operation and stable throughput make it suitable for industrial recycling facilities.

Particles are charged and then passed through electric fields. Differences in electrical behaviour allow separation into distinct fractions.
Separated materials are collected as distinct streams for sale or reprocessing.
This process works on black, mixed, and previously difficult‑to‑sort plastics.

Technology: Optical💠Best For: Sorters Colour‑distinct plastics💠Limitation: Struggle with black plastics
Technology: Density💠Best For: Separation Different densities💠Limitation: Cannot separate same‑density polymers
Technology: Electrostatic (KRS)💠Best For: Electrical behaviour differences💠Limitation: Requires dry, prepared feed
This highlights why electrostatic systems like the hamos KRS offer value where others fall short.
